White Pine is 9-1 against Pershing County since September of 2018, and they'll have a chance to extend that success on Friday. The White Pine Bobcats will stay at home for another game and welcome the Pershing County Mustangs at 3:00 p.m. White Pine will be strutting in after a win while Pershing County will be coming in after a defeat.
White Pine's defense heads into the matchup hoping to repeat the dominance they displayed on Saturday. Everything went their way against West Wendover as White Pine made off with a 6-0 victory. The high-scoring effort was just what the Bobcats needed considering they were shutout in their previous game.
Their offense was hitting West Wendover from everywhere, as five different players booted in a goal.
Cecilia Barbosa led that balanced group of strikers and accounted for two goals all by herself.
Meanwhile, after soaring to 12 goals the game before, Pershing County was a bit more limited in their match on Tuesday. They came up short against Lowry, falling 11-0. The Mustangs haven't had much luck with the Buckaroos recently, as the team's come up short the last four times they've met.
White Pine's win bumped their record up to 2-7. As for Pershing County, their loss dropped their record down to 4-6-1.
White Pine came up short against Pershing County in their previous meeting on September 6th, falling 2-0. Can White Pine avenge their defeat or is history doomed to repeat itself? We'll find out soon enough.
